"use strict";
var _a;
Object.defineProperty(exports, "__esModule", { value: true });
exports.MonitoringFacade = void 0;
const JSII_RTTI_SYMBOL_1 = Symbol.for("jsii.rtti");
const aws_cdk_lib_1 = require("aws-cdk-lib");
const common_1 = require("../common");
const dashboard_1 = require("../dashboard");
const monitoring_1 = require("../monitoring");
const MonitoringAspect_1 = require("./MonitoringAspect");
/**
* Main entry point to create your monitoring.
*/
class MonitoringFacade extends common_1.MonitoringScope {
constructor(scope, id, props) {
super(scope, id);
this.metricFactoryDefaults =
props?.metricFactoryDefaults ??
MonitoringFacade.getDefaultMetricFactoryDefaults();
this.alarmFactoryDefaults =
props?.alarmFactoryDefaults ??
MonitoringFacade.getDefaultAlarmFactoryDefaults(id);
this.dashboardFactory =
props?.dashboardFactory ??
MonitoringFacade.getDefaultDashboardFactory(this, id);
this.createdSegments = [];
}
static getDefaultMetricFactoryDefaults() {
return {};
}
static getDefaultAlarmFactoryDefaults(defaultName) {
return {
alarmNamePrefix: defaultName,
actionsEnabled: true,
};
}
static getDefaultDashboardFactory(scope, defaultName) {
return new dashboard_1.DefaultDashboardFactory(scope, `${defaultName}-Dashboards`, {
dashboardNamePrefix: defaultName,
});
}
// FACTORIES
// =========
createAlarmFactory(alarmNamePrefix) {
return new common_1.AlarmFactory(this, {
globalAlarmDefaults: this.alarmFactoryDefaults,
globalMetricDefaults: this.metricFactoryDefaults,
localAlarmNamePrefix: alarmNamePrefix,
});
}
createAwsConsoleUrlFactory() {
const stack = aws_cdk_lib_1.Stack.of(this);
const awsAccountId = stack.account;
const awsAccountRegion = stack.region;
return new common_1.AwsConsoleUrlFactory({ awsAccountRegion, awsAccountId });
}
createMetricFactory() {
return new common_1.MetricFactory({ globalDefaults: this.metricFactoryDefaults });
}
createWidgetFactory() {
return new dashboard_1.DefaultWidgetFactory();
}
// GENERIC
// =======
createdDashboard() {
return this.dashboardFactory?.createdDashboard();
}
createdSummaryDashboard() {
return this.dashboardFactory?.createdSummaryDashboard();
}
createdAlarmDashboard() {
return this.dashboardFactory?.createdAlarmDashboard();
}
/**
* Returns the created alarms across all the monitorings added up until now.
*/
createdAlarms() {
const alarms = [];
this.createdSegments.forEach((monitoring) => {
if (monitoring instanceof common_1.Monitoring) {
alarms.push(...monitoring.createdAlarms());
}
});
return alarms;
}
/**
* Returns a subset of created alarms that are marked by a specific custom tag.
* @param customTag tag to filter alarms by
*/
createdAlarmsWithTag(customTag) {
return this.createdAlarms().filter((alarm) => alarm.customTags?.includes(customTag));
}
/**
* Returns a subset of created alarms that are marked by a specific disambiguator.
* @param disambiguator disambiguator to filter alarms by
*/
createdAlarmsWithDisambiguator(disambiguator) {
return this.createdAlarms().filter((alarm) => alarm.disambiguator === disambiguator);
}
/**
* Finds a subset of created alarms that are marked by a specific custom tag and creates a composite alarm.
* This composite alarm is created with an 'OR' condition, so it triggers with any child alarm.
* NOTE: This composite alarm is not added among other alarms, so it is not returned by createdAlarms() calls.
*
* @param customTag tag to filter alarms by
* @param props customization options
*/
createCompositeAlarmUsingTag(customTag, props) {
const alarms = this.createdAlarmsWithTag(customTag);
if (alarms.length > 0) {
const disambiguator = props?.disambiguator ?? customTag;
const alarmFactory = this.createAlarmFactory("Composite");
return alarmFactory.addCompositeAlarm(alarms, {
...(props ?? {}),
disambiguator,
});
}
return undefined;
}
/**
* Finds a subset of created alarms that are marked by a specific disambiguator and creates a composite alarm.
* This composite alarm is created with an 'OR' condition, so it triggers with any child alarm.
* NOTE: This composite alarm is not added among other alarms, so it is not returned by createdAlarms() calls.
*
* @param alarmDisambiguator disambiguator to filter alarms by
* @param props customization options
*/
createCompositeAlarmUsingDisambiguator(alarmDisambiguator, props) {
const alarms = this.createdAlarmsWithDisambiguator(alarmDisambiguator);
if (alarms.length > 0) {
const disambiguator = props?.disambiguator ?? alarmDisambiguator;
const alarmFactory = this.createAlarmFactory("Composite");
return alarmFactory.addCompositeAlarm(alarms, {
...(props ?? {}),
disambiguator,
});
}
return undefined;
}
/**
* Returns the created monitorings added up until now.
*/
createdMonitorings() {
return this.createdSegments
.filter((s) => s instanceof common_1.Monitoring)
.map((s) => s);
}
addSegment(segment, overrideProps) {
this.dashboardFactory?.addSegment({ segment, overrideProps });
this.createdSegments.push(segment);
return this;
}
addLargeHeader(text, addToSummary, addToAlarm) {
this.addWidget(new dashboard_1.HeaderWidget(text, dashboard_1.HeaderLevel.LARGE), addToSummary ?? false, addToAlarm ?? false);
return this;
}
addMediumHeader(text, addToSummary, addToAlarm) {
this.addWidget(new dashboard_1.HeaderWidget(text, dashboard_1.HeaderLevel.MEDIUM), addToSummary ?? false, addToAlarm ?? false);
return this;
}
addSmallHeader(text, addToSummary, addToAlarm) {
this.addWidget(new dashboard_1.HeaderWidget(text, dashboard_1.HeaderLevel.SMALL), addToSummary ?? false, addToAlarm ?? false);
return this;
}
addWidget(widget, addToSummary, addToAlarm) {
this.addSegment(new dashboard_1.SingleWidgetDashboardSegment(widget, addToSummary, addToAlarm));
return this;
}
